The cheapest way to get from Hounslow to Guildford is to drive which costs £5 - £8 and takes 35 min.
The fastest way to get from Hounslow to Guildford is to drive which takes 35 min and costs £5 - £8.
No, there is no direct bus from Hounslow to Guildford station. However, there are services departing from The Bell and arriving at Guildford station via Heathrow Terminal 5.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 6m.
No, there is no direct train from Hounslow to Guildford. However, there are services departing from Hounslow and arriving at Guildford via Clapham Junction.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 29m.
The distance between Hounslow and Guildford is 36 miles. The road distance is 22.2 miles.
The best way to get from Hounslow to Guildford without a car is to train which takes 1h 29m and costs £16 - £40.
It takes approximately 1h 29m to get from Hounslow to Guildford, including transfers.
Hounslow to Guildford bus services, operated by First Bus London, depart from The Bell station.
Hounslow to Guildford train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Hounslow station.
The best way to get from Hounslow to Guildford is to train which takes 1h 29m and costs £16 - £40.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 2h 6m.
